About

The character is a phono-semantic compound, combining the fire radical on the left, which indicates the semantic category of fire, burning, and heat, with the phonetic component on the right, which supplies the sound. Originally, the character meant soot, the black, powdery carbon residue left behind by a burning fire. Over time, the primary meaning shifted to coal, a combustible black sedimentary rock commonly used as a solid fuel. This shift from a fire's byproduct to the fuel that feeds a fire reflects a coherent semantic extension, with the fire radical underlying both senses.
